Output d50ec509de0edb5156f25512c616d4a44996a92bdded656a3990e51df3381526:1

value
2998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f65162b99a423fa52ef65bfd4ec0d63309f909b OP_EQUAL
address
3DJcqXVSGZEeZvzVVXusnG4kWhBbRu668Z
transaction
d50ec509de0edb5156f25512c616d4a44996a92bdded656a3990e51df3381526
spent
true